ALLEN, Chief Justice.
Defendant William Verrinder appeals his conviction for second-degree murder and sentence to a term of twenty years to life. We affirm.
At around 6:30 in the evening of July 29, 1991, defendant shot and killed Kenneth Bullock. Defendant is a Vietnam veteran who has experienced the symptoms of posttraumatic stress syndrome (PTSD).
